There are special laws that apply just to cruise ships. For example, cruise lines often insert special provisions into their passenger tickets that shorten the time in which a passenger may file a law suit against the cruise line to one year. The normal statute of limitations for admiralty and maritime matters is three years. Also cruise lines can designate, within their passenger tickets, the only location where they can be sued. This is referred to as a forum selection clause. Most of the major cruise lines are based in Miami, Florida and designate Miami, Florida as the location where they must be sued.
Also, almost every cruise line vessel is registered in a foreign country and flies a foreign flag. The law of the country of registration of the vessel could potentially apply to events on cruise vessels and could potentially be more favorable to the claimant than United States law.
Claims against the cruise lines also include actions for: wrongful death, sexual assault, passenger disappearance, negligent security, and other injuries that occurred on board or while participating on a cruise.
